"Not every client is your ideal client. It is alright to say 'no' and that is ok," with Alexandra Di Nella

Alexandra Di Nella, the Founder of YZ Talents, a tech recruitment agency, is an ex-BCG Project Lead and had been working within the technology and digital space for the past 10+ years. Prior to joining BCG, she was building companies for VCs in Berlin and other European capitals. To date, Alexandra is coaching teams in Founders Institute, University of Miami, in VCs competitions on a variety of subjects from idea origination to geographical expansion. Her focus is on operational excellence and technology/product offer.

How did you start your business? What were the first steps you took?

I always knew I wanted to have my own business and after 6 years in the industry, I started to make some definitive steps towards that goal. Switching from tech consulting to tech recruitment took a while, I started to source and recruit myself first to get familiar with all the details of the process, interactions, and details in order to then train my own consultants in my own team.

How do you differentiate your business from the competition?

Deep technology knowledge: we make sure that all consultants are properly trained via our Academy (based on which we published a course this year called “The Good recruiter & Co”), which covers everything from communication standards to the technicalities of each role.

Individual approach: we prefer to focus on the area of our expertise and remain boutique and very close to the client, which allows us to respond with speed and agility to challenges our clients face. 

What has been your most effective marketing strategy to grow your business?

We issue a monthly newsletter to the candidates in our database providing helpful tips on how to get the role they want. Often, we get referrals from our candidates, which we value very much as it shows the trust in our team. 

What's your best piece of advice for aspiring and new entrepreneurs?

Not every client is your ideal client. It is alright to say “no” and that is ok.

Evaluate what industries, client size, growth rate works for you and your business and assemble the criteria to follow when searching for the client base.
